During tonight’s episode of Big Brother, the four evicted houseguests will have the chance to compete to return to the house. CBS has given us a look at what the competition will look like, which gives us a bit to speculate on while we wait for tonight’s episode. If you don’t want to be spoiled on how the comeback competition will work, look no further!

CBS posted this sneak peek at the competition, which they have labeled “Comeback Fight.” It looks like a computer generated mock-up of what the competition will (vaguely) look like…

So it seems like this will be following along the lines of Season 13 when Brendon won his way back into the house. (Remember when Lawon volunteered to be evicted because he thought he’d get to come back into the house with special powers?) Brendon and Lawon faced off in a competition and Brendon won a second chance to get back into the house.

Last season, when there was a returning houseguests, the four jurors competed alongside the remaining houseguests in a semi-endurance competition where houseguests stood on a perch against a wall and had to catch flying baseballs. The four evicted houseguests were sectioned off and the last among them (either last to fall off their perch or first to catch ten balls and win the HoH competition, whichever came first) got to return to the house. Judd won that one.
